Credit: OSEN Kim Sa Ron’s anticipated return to acting has been abruptly canceled as she stepped down from the upcoming play Dongchimi, which was set to mark her comeback to the stage. Dongchimi is a long-running family drama that paints a picture of a taciturn father who knows nothing but his family, a mother who gives everything she has, and three siblings who, despite their childish quarrels, are deeply devoted to their parents. The fantasy romance drama “Lovely Runner” has successfully captured attention of viewers around the globe! According to global OTT (over-the-top) platform Rakuten Viki, “Lovely Runner” ranked No. 1 in viewership in 133 regions including the United States, Canada, France, Germany, Italy, Brazil, Mexico, and more in the week the drama premiered. The drama is also maintaining a high viewer rating of 9.8 on Viki with favorable reviews from subscribers. Credit: Netflix Netflix has experienced a substantial increase in its revenue in South Korea, with a boost of approximately 50 billion KRW (approximately 36 million USD) last year, attributed largely to the popularity of the hit series The Glory and the implementation of paid account sharing. According to the 2023 audit report by Netflix Services Korea, the company’s revenue in the South Korean market was about 823.34 billion KRW (595 million USD), marking a significant rise from the previous year.
